/**
|
|
* Try to detect remote host from an SSH wrapper script like:
|
|
* exec ssh -T clawdbot@192.168.64.3 /opt/homebrew/bin/imsg "$@"
|
|
* exec ssh -T mac-mini imsg "$@"
|
|
* Returns the user@host or host portion if found, undefined otherwise.
|
|
*/
|
|
async function detectRemoteHostFromCliPath(cliPath: string): Promise<string | undefined> {
|
|
try {
|
|
// Expand ~ to home directory
|
|
const expanded = cliPath.startsWith("~")
|
|
? cliPath.replace(/^~/, process.env.HOME ?? "")
|
|
: cliPath;
|
|
const content = await fs.readFile(expanded, "utf8");
|
|
|
|
// Match user@host pattern first (e.g., clawdbot@192.168.64.3)
|
|
const userHostMatch = content.match(/\bssh\b[^\n]*?\s+([a-zA-Z0-9._-]+@[a-zA-Z0-9._-]+)/);
|
|
if (userHostMatch) return userHostMatch[1];
|
|
|
|
// Fallback: match host-only before imsg command (e.g., ssh -T mac-mini imsg)
|
|
const hostOnlyMatch = content.match(/\bssh\b[^\n]*?\s+([a-zA-Z][a-zA-Z0-9._-]*)\s+\S*\bimsg\b/);
|
|
return hostOnlyMatch?.[1];
|
|
} catch {
|
|
return undefined;
|
|
}
|
|
}
